Kiryat Shmona (KSW) to Kuwait City (KWI)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Kiryat Shmona Airport (KSW) in Kiryat Shmona, Israel to Kuwait International Airport (KWI) in Kuwait City, Kuwait is 1,257 kilometers (781 miles / 679 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 2h, flying east southeast at a heading of 107°.

This is a short-haul route typically served by narrow-body aircraft such as the Boeing 737 or Airbus A320 family. In-flight service is usually limited to drinks and light snacks.

This is an international route connecting Israel with Kuwait.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 08:36 in Kiryat Shmona, it's 09:36 in Kuwait City.

The return flight from Kuwait City (KWI) to Kiryat Shmona (KSW) follows a heading of 294° (west northwest).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
